WebIn the 1980s the park board began efforts to restore the unique five-acre Quaking Bog in the park and to eradicate invasive species of plants that had taken hold in Wirth Park as well as many other parks. Extensive efforts to control those species were targeted especially at the bog and the Eloise Butler Wildflower Garden. WebExperience this 1.2-mile loop trail near Minneapolis, Minnesota.
